深入解析源码文件夹:探索软件开发的秘密花园
在软件开发的领域中,源码文件夹是一个神秘而充满活力的地方。它就像是一座秘密花园,隐藏着软件的诞生与成长过程。每一个源码文件夹都承载着开发者的智慧与汗水,是软件世界的基石。本文将带领读者走进源码文件夹,揭开其神秘的面纱。
一、源码文件夹的定义
源码文件夹,顾名思义,就是存放软件源代码的文件夹。源代码是软件开发的基础,它由一系列编程语言编写而成,是软件程序的核心。源码文件夹中的文件类型通常包括C、C++、Java、Python、PHP等编程语言编写的文件,以及相应的配置文件、文档、库文件等。
二、源码文件夹的结构
一个典型的源码文件夹通常包含以下几个部分:
1.主项目文件夹:这是源码文件夹的根目录,包含项目的所有文件和文件夹。
2.源代码文件夹:存放项目的主要源代码文件,如C++的.cpp
、Java的.java
等。
3.库文件夹:存放项目所依赖的第三方库文件,如OpenCV、Boost等。
4.配置文件夹:存放项目的配置文件,如Makefile、CMakeLists.txt等。
5.文档文件夹:存放项目的文档,如README、README.md、CHANGES等。
6.测试文件夹:存放项目的测试代码和测试用例,如单元测试、集成测试等。
7.脚本文件夹:存放项目的自动化脚本,如安装脚本、编译脚本等。
三、源码文件夹的作用
1.管理源代码:源码文件夹为开发者提供了一个有序的环境,方便管理和维护源代码。
2.组织项目结构:通过合理划分文件夹,源码文件夹有助于组织项目的模块和功能,提高开发效率。
3.便于协作:在团队开发中,源码文件夹为团队成员提供了共同的工作空间,方便协作和交流。
4.便于版本控制:源码文件夹中的文件可以通过版本控制系统(如Git)进行版本控制,确保代码的稳定性和可追溯性。
5.便于调试和测试:源码文件夹中的测试代码和测试用例有助于开发者调试和测试软件,提高软件质量。
四、如何进入源码文件夹
1.打开源码文件夹:在文件管理器中找到源码文件夹的路径,双击进入。
2.使用命令行:在命令行中输入源码文件夹的路径,然后按Enter键进入。
3.使用IDE:在集成开发环境中,通常可以找到源码文件夹的路径,直接打开即可。
五、总结
源码文件夹是软件开发中不可或缺的一部分,它承载着软件的诞生与成长。深入了解源码文件夹的结构、作用和进入方法,有助于开发者更好地掌握软件开发技巧,提高开发效率。在这个秘密花园中,开发者可以尽情探索,挖掘软件开发的无限可能。